1. Omitted by the Tribunals Reforms Act, 2021, w.r.e.f. 4-4-2021. Prior to its omission section 92, read as under:"92. Procedure and powers of Appellate Board. - (1) The Appellate Board shall not be bound by the procedure laid down in the Code of Civil Procedure, 1908 (5 of 1908) but shall be guided by principles of natural justice and subject to the provisions of this Act and the rules made thereunder, the Appellate Board shall have powers to regulate its own procedure including the fixing of places and times of its hearing.(2) The Appellate Board shall have, for the purpose of discharging its functions under this Act, the same powers as are vested in a civil court under the Code of Civil Procedure, 1908 (5 of 1908) while trying a suit in respect of the following matters, namely :-
(a)
-
receiving evidence;
(b)
-
issuing commissions for examination of witnesses;
